readthedocs.org で管理されているドキュメントがあります。パスワードで保護する方法、または少なくとも一部の顧客のみがドキュメントを利用できるようにする方法はありますか?
1 に答える
残念ながら、Read The Docs でホストされているドキュメントはパスワードで保護できません。
(現時点で) できる最善の方法は、ドキュメントを「非公開」に設定することです。これにより、ユーザーが www.readthedocs.org Web サイトからドキュメントに移動したときに 404 が表示されます。ただし、実際の URL を知っている人なら誰でもドキュメントを表示できるため、これは非常に脆弱なセキュリティです。
ドキュメントから:
実際のドキュメントを表示する URL があれば、非公開のドキュメントも表示できます。これは、可用性を高めるために、アーキテクチャがドキュメントの表示に関するロジックを実行しないためです。
ただし、Sphinx で生成されたドキュメントを自分でホストすることもでき、パスワードで保護することもできます。それが間違いなくあなたの最善の策だと思います!
Read the Docs は本当に単なる便利なホスティング サービスです。ドキュメントを別の場所にホストして、他のものをパスワードで保護するのと同じように簡単にパスワードで保護することができます。
アップデート
make html
ところで、これを行う最も簡単な方法は、ルート フォルダーから使用して、静的な .html ファイルを生成することです。これらの HTML ファイルを内部でホストされている Web サーバーに配置すれば、問題ありません :)